This fascinating and erudite talk by Jeremy Rifkin for Google explores how "empathetic consciousness" restructures the ways people organize their personal lives, approach knowledge, pursue science and technology, conduct commerce and governance, and orchestrate civil society. Rifkin presents the idea that major changes in human consciousness occur when new communication and energy technologies allow a greater empathic embrace with other human beings. It is a fact-packed and mind-stretching presentation that is 57 mins long, but well worth watching in full.
Jeremy Rifkin is president of the Foundation on Economic Trends and the author of seventeen bestselling books on the impact of scientific and technological changes on the economy, the workforce, society, and the environment, such as The European Dream, The Hydrogen Economy, The Age of Access, The Biotech Century, and The End of Work.
